Abstract

The main objective of this study is to know the opportunities for people with disabilities to access university education in the city of Huánuco. This objective was achieved with the information gathered during the research process. The scope of the study is the universities in the city of Huanuco. The study population is made up of five thousand people with some kind of disability but who are able to pursue university studies, having determined a sample of 264 people. The level and type of research is exploratory and descriptive, being the research design non-experimental and transversal. Through a survey, validated by experts and with a reliability of 0.932, the information collected was processed, analyzed and systematized according to the requirements of scientific research. The results indicate that people with disabilities are subject to social exclusion and, while there are opportunities to pursue higher education, there are also many limitations.
